The Risks and Rewards of Eyeball Tattooing

Eyeball tattooing, referred to as sclera ink, is a extreme form of body modification that involves injecting permanent pigment into the white part of the eye. While a few thrill-seekers are drawn to its artistic value, it's crucial to ponder the potential risks and rewards before attempting this procedure.

  • The biggest hazard of eyeball tattooing is the potential for infection. The eye is a delicate organ, and any foreign substance can lead to serious complications.
  • Furthermore, permanent vision impairment or even blindness is a potential outcome.
  • On the other hand, proponents argue that eyeball tattooing can accentuate one's appearance, giving them a distinctive look.

Ultimately, the decision to get your eyeballs tattooed is a private one. Make sure to do your research, consult with experienced professionals, and completely comprehend the risks involved before making this permanent choice.
